I use the myfitness calorie counter as a guide and a meal planner. I often adjust dinner calories, if during the course of the day, I've overdone eating at breakfast or lunch. I stay below my calorie goal most of the time, especially when I do an exercise regimen that day. But the key is to have a reliable scale, and weigh yourself daily. This will confirm whether you had a "good" or "bad" day controlling your calories the day before. The scale results help to keep me on target with my calorie goals.0
